#11b738 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11b738 is composed of 6.7% red, 71.8%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.4%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 134.1 degrees, a saturation of 83% and a lightness of 39.2%. #11b738 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ff70 with #006f00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#11b738 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#11b738 has RGB values of R:17, G:183,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 1161016.

Shades and Tints of #11b738
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000401 is the darkest color, while #f1fef4 is the lightest one.
